General Mobile DSTL1 Imaginary
General Mobile will be showing off its DSTL1 Imaginary Handset. It is an Android Based Phone which supports dual SIM and will be debut at the 2009 Mobile World Congress.

The new handset will be powered by the popular Android OS and a Marvell PXA 310 624MHz processor with NXP 5209 chipset, 256MB Flash memory and 128MB RAM.

The DSTL1 also comes equipped with a 3-inch touchscreen display, a 5 Megapixel auto focus camera with flash, microSD card slot for memory expansion, WiFi and Bluetooth Connectivity. There was no price announced and you can see more photos after the jump
